COTI LEAD PEER

Minimum Qualifications: High School Diploma or GED equivalent. CRPA required. 1 year supervisory experience preferred. Valid NYS Drivers’ License.
Job Summary: In accordance with the organization’s mission, vision and values, the COTI lead peer is responsible for ensuring supervisory support to department peers as well as administrative support to the COTI program as needed and under the oversight and direction of program management. Responsibilities include but are not limited to:
Duties:
1. Provide regular support and supervision to peers in the department in coordination with program manager, ensuring operation within the peer scope of practice and agency directive, and appropriate peer self care
2. Assist in the daily management of work flow for the COTI manager, including monitoring and coordinating the deployment of direct care COTI staff as needed
3. Provide in community services
4. Assist in compilation and preparation of statistical data and reports as needed
5. Interface with provider agencies and maintain positive working relationships
6. Help expand regional familiarity and use of COTI and agency services
7. Participate as part of the agency peer leadership team as needed include training/credentialing
8. Participation in the COTI on call rotation
9. Schedule will require a mixture of day/eve/weekend hours
10. Perform other duties and functions as directed.
